About This Coffee
The CESMACH co-op is thriving with 224 women members—a diverse group including widows, private landowners, and those whose husbands have sought work elsewhere. Their commitment to empowerment is clear: one woman now holds a coveted seat on the board of directors. This is a massive stride forward in Mexico, a state with a traditionally machista culture. These producers aren't just growing coffee; they're pushing the boundaries of quality, striving for the "perfect cup" while upholding CESMACH's strict standards, including organic and fair trade certifications. Their story is a powerful blend of resilience, passion, and love for the craft. Having worked with coffee their entire lives, these women inherently understand the hard work, focused labor, and smart management required to succeed. The environment itself is extraordinary. The farms are nestled in the buffer zone of the El Triunfo Biosphere Reserve in the Sierra Madre highlands. This is one of the planet's most diverse forest reserves, home to Mesoamerica's largest cloud forest and a sanctuary for thousands of species. In this special place, all the coffee is proudly shade-grown. This year's Mexico harvest has been exceptional, even at the field blend or cooperative level (beyond microlots). We selected this coffee for Perennial Artisan Ale’s Coffee Stout for its dessert like notes of chocolate, tree nuts, and caramelized sugars.
